Note: With this tool, you can know the radius of a circle anywhere on Google Maps by simply clicking on a single point and extending or moving the circle … WebBluetooth uses radio frequencies between 2.4 and 2.483Ghz. The Federal Communications Commission set this range aside for low-power general use, called the industrial, scientific and medical band. The Bluetooth standard breaks the ISM radio range into 79 separate channels and sends data over combinations of them.

WebThey are way more accurate and reliable than anything that is using the power of the received signal (typically, all ranging solutions based on Wifi or Bluetooth). At short range, accuracy can be around a centimeter, decreasing at longer range. Range can be 20-70m, specially in a "easy" setting such as a park outdoors.
